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  1. The two main divisions of the skeleton are the axial and appendicular skeletons. The axial skeleton forms the central axis of the body.
  2. Sutural bones are the extra - bones that develop between the flat bones of the skull.
  3. The cranium and facial bones together make up the skull.
  4. The hyoid bone supports the tongue and is unique as it does not articulate with any other bone directly.
  5. The coccyx at the inferior end of the sacrum is composed of four fused vertebrae.
  6. Most ribs are attached anteriorly to the sternum.
  7. The thoracic cage is composed of 12 pairs of ribs.
  8. The scapulae and clavicles form the pectoral girdle.
  9. The humerus, radius, and ulna articulate to form the elbow joint.
  10. The wrist is composed of eight carpal bones.
  11. The hip bones are attached posteriorly to the sacrum.
  12. The patella covers the anterior surface of the knee.
  13. The bones that articulate with the distal ends of the tibia and fibula are the tarsal bones.
  14. All finger and toe bones are called phalanges.
